- Abstract
- Uncooled pyroelectric infrared based on semiconducting YBa2Cu3O7-x (YBCO) thin films have been investigated. YBCO precursor solutions were prepared by sol-gel method and YBCO films were fabricated by the spin coating method and structural and electrical properties with variation of coating number were studied. The crystal structure of the YBCO film annealed at 750 degrees C was polycrystalline tetragonal phase. The YBCO film coated with 5 times showed the average grain size of 75 nm and thickness of 185nm. Temperature resistance coefficient (TCR), responsivity and detectivity of the YBCO film sintered at 700 degrees C were -3%/degrees C, 43.42V/W and 5.34 x 10(6) cmHz1/2/W, respectively.
